tomcat服务器从memcached缓存里面设置Session

1.分别向tomcat的lib中添加jar包,jar包目录如下(192.168.2.140和192.168.2.136)

tomcat服务器从memcached缓存里面设置Session

创新互联公司2013年成立,是专业互联网技术服务公司,拥有项目网站设计、网站建设网站策划,项目实施与项目整合能力。我们以让每一个梦想脱颖而出为使命,1280元五峰做网站,已为上家服务,为五峰各地企业和个人服务,联系电话:13518219792

2.修改tomcat的配置文件server.xml,在中,添加jvmRoute,将jvmRoute的名称添加为tomcat1,tomcat2同样的操作

vi server.xml
#192.168.2.140下的tomcat添加


#192.168.2.136下的tomcat添加

3.修改tomcat1中的index.jsp和tomcat2中的index.jsp

vi server.xml


<%@ page language="java"contentType="text/html; charset=UTF-8"  pageEncoding="UTF-8"%>

SessionID:<%=session.getId()%>

SessionIP:<%=request.getServerName()%>

tomcat1


<%@ page language="java"contentType="text/html; charset=UTF-8"  pageEncoding="UTF-8"%>

SessionID:<%=session.getId()%>

SessionIP:<%=request.getServerName()%>

tomcat2

4.启动tomcat

./startup.sh

5.分别访问192.168.2.140:8080和192.168.2.136:8080,可以观察到Session是不一致的

tomcat服务器从memcached缓存里面设置Session

tomcat服务器从memcached缓存里面设置Session

6.配置tomcat中的conf目录下的context.xml文件,添加如下内容

7.重启tomcat后进行访问查看

./shutdown.sh
./startup.sh

本文标题:tomcat服务器从memcached缓存里面设置Session
网页链接:http://scyanting.com/article/gijeco.html